Panic Attacks
1. Now don't laugh at this because it will sound odd but it is scientifically proven: Place your face into cold water for at least 15-30 seconds. The shock of the water actually activates an evolutionary response that we have too being submerged. Your breathing slows, your heart rate slows and your body goes into a more relaxed state. It's called the Mammalian Diving Response. Read up on it if you like it really works!

Trauma and PTSD
Roughly 20% of people who have suffered through a severely traumatic experience or repeated trauma will develop PTSD. Also known as Post Traumatic Stress Disorder, this condition can last a short time, or in some cases, can cause symptoms and behaviors that last for years, decades, or the reminder of a person's life.
